Leadership Review Briefing — Pilot Churn

The Lanternview pilot lost 9 of 62 enrolled customers in month two, above the 8% threshold we set. Exit interviews cite onboarding friction rather than pricing. Revised onboarding flow ships next sprint; retention credits have been capped. Finance exposure remains within the approved pilot budget. One confidential planning note follows for restricted circulation.

board note of tawig-bajof: The renewal with Ralixix Holdings closes at $10 million a year, 20 percent above the last contract. Project Druix slips by two quarters because of the tooling delay.

## Nightfill 4.0 — Changed Defaults

Nightfill's scheduler now defaults to windowed backfills instead of full-table replays. Plugins that relied on the implicit full replay must declare it explicitly or they will silently process only the trailing window. Retry backoff is now exponential by default; the old linear mode remains available behind a flag. Concurrency caps dropped from 16 to 8 per tenant. Plugin authors should re-test against these values before publishing against the 4.x line. The new default configuration ships as follows.

service settings:
PRAWYN_PIN=9848
PRAWYN_METRICS_HOST=metrics.prawyn.lumicworks.corp
PRAWYN_LOG_LEVEL=warn
PRAWYN_TENANT=pelius

**Ticket: Stalled runs after cron → Orchestrune migration**

Hey new folks — quick context. We moved the old cron jobs onto Orchestrune last sprint, and a few workers are failing auth because their env files were copied without the scheduler credential. Fix is easy: open the worker's .env and add the token line right here:

sealed setting: LEDGER_TOKEN13=5d842615a26d7

## v2.9.0 — Pagination changes

Hey, welcome aboard! The Tidemark public API now uses cursor-based pagination everywhere; the old page/offset params are deprecated and will 400 after the next release. Grab cursors from the meta block. Docs are updated in the contractor portal. Any questions on the cutover should go to the maintainer listed below.

named custodian: Belius Casath Ulaix Sorius